Day 1 Journey Through Antiquity: Pyramids & Pharaohs

09:00 AM

Explore the Giza Pyramids and Sphinx

Begin your day with a private guided tour of the iconic Giza Plateau, home to the Great Pyramids of Giza and the Sphinx. Marvel at these ancient wonders, learn about their history and construction, and capture breathtaking photos. Consider an optional camel ride for a classic desert experience.

01:00 PM

Gourmet Lunch with Pyramid Views

Indulge in a luxurious lunch at a restaurant offering unparalleled panoramic views of the Giza Pyramids, perhaps from an exclusive terrace. Savor a blend of international and Egyptian delicacies in an elegant setting.

03:00 PM

Discover Saqqara and the Step Pyramid

Journey to Saqqara, an ancient burial ground serving as the necropolis for the ancient Egyptian capital, Memphis. Explore the Step Pyramid of Djoser, considered the world's first stone building, and visit the Imhotep Museum and various mastaba tombs showcasing intricate hieroglyphics.

07:30 PM

Nile River Dinner Cruise with Entertainment

Conclude your day with a magical evening on a luxury Nile River dinner cruise. Enjoy a sumptuous buffet or à la carte dinner, live entertainment including traditional belly dancing and Sufi whirling dervishes, all while cruising past Cairo's illuminated skyline.

Day 2 Grandeur of Museums & Charms of Islamic Cairo

09:00 AM

Immersive Visit to the Grand Egyptian Museum (GEM)

Spend your morning exploring the magnificent Grand Egyptian Museum (GEM), an architectural marvel housing an unparalleled collection of ancient Egyptian artifacts, including the complete Tutankhamun collection. Allow ample time to fully appreciate this world-class institution.

01:00 PM

Upscale Egyptian Lunch in Zamalek

Cross over to Zamalek Island for a gourmet lunch experience at a highly-rated restaurant specializing in refined Egyptian cuisine. Enjoy traditional flavors in a sophisticated, contemporary setting popular with locals and expats.

03:00 PM

Guided Exploration of Khan el-Khalili and Islamic Cairo

Embark on a private guided tour through the labyrinthine alleys of Khan el-Khalili bazaar. Beyond souvenir shops, discover hidden artisan workshops, historic cafes, and magnificent Islamic architecture. Visit nearby Al-Azhar Mosque and the El-Moez Street for a deeper dive into Cairo's rich Islamic heritage.

07:30 PM

Exclusive Dining Experience with Nile Views

Enjoy an evening of exquisite fine dining at one of Zamalek's most exclusive establishments, many of which offer stunning views of the Nile. Savor gourmet cuisine, curated wine selections, and impeccable service in an elegant ambiance.

Day 3 Coptic Heritage & Citadel Majesty

09:00 AM

Journey Through Coptic Cairo's Sacred Sites

Explore the historic heart of Coptic Cairo with a private guide. Visit the Hanging Church (Saint Virgin Mary's Coptic Orthodox Church), one of the oldest churches in Egypt, the Abu Serga Church (Cavern Church), and the Ben Ezra Synagogue. Immerse yourself in the rich religious history of the area.

01:00 PM

Refined Lunch in Garden City

Enjoy a sophisticated lunch in the upscale Garden City district, known for its elegant ambiance and diplomatic residences. Choose from a selection of fine restaurants offering international or contemporary Egyptian cuisine in a serene setting.

03:00 PM

Ascend to the Citadel of Salah al-Din and Muhammad Ali Mosque

Visit the majestic Citadel of Salah al-Din, a medieval Islamic fortress offering panoramic views of Cairo. Explore the stunning Muhammad Ali Mosque, an Ottoman-era mosque with its distinctive alabaster exterior and grand interior, symbolizing Egyptian independence.

07:30 PM

Farewell Dinner with Panoramic City Views at Cairo Tower

Conclude your Cairo journey with a memorable farewell dinner at the revolving restaurant atop the Cairo Tower. Enjoy a exquisite meal and unparalleled 360-degree panoramic views of the entire city, beautifully illuminated at night, offering a perfect end to your luxury experience.

Where to stay, eat & get around

Cairo works on every budget. Here is how it breaks down across three tiers.

🛌 Where to stay

Budget: Downtown Cairo (especially around Talaat Harb or Tahrir Square for essential but central stays), Ramses Square area (for strong transport links and local markets).
Mid-range: Garden City (serene, diplomatic district with elegant boutique hotels), Dokki (residential, vibrant local life, well-connected to major attractions), parts of Mohandessin.
Luxury: Zamalek Island (Cairo's most affluent and artistic district with high-end boutiques and Nile views), Nile Corniche (prime riverside locations boasting international luxury hotel brands), select exclusive resorts near the Giza Pyramids for unparalleled ancient views.

🚉 Getting around

Budget: Cairo Metro (most efficient for specific routes downtown and across the Nile), local microbuses/minivans (for adventurous travelers familiar with local routes).
Mid-range: Uber/Careem (reliable ridesharing apps offering a good balance of cost and convenience), combining Cairo Metro for longer distances with ridesharing for last-mile access.
Luxury: Private chauffeured luxury sedans (pre-booked for door-to-door comfort), dedicated hotel limousine services, specialized tour vehicles with professional drivers and multilingual guides.

🍽 Where to eat

Budget: Khan el-Khalili bazaar (authentic street food, local cafes offering falafel and koshary), Downtown Cairo (Tahrir area for famous local eateries like Abou Tarek for Koshary), local neighborhood spots in Dokki or Mohandessin.
Mid-range: Zamalek (diverse array of trendy bistros, international and refined Egyptian cuisine), Garden City (upscale cafes and international dining), selected restaurants in Downtown Cairo offering elevated local dishes in stylish settings.
Luxury: Nile-side fine dining restaurants (particularly in Zamalek and along the Corniche for exquisite views and international menus), exclusive hotel restaurants known for their culinary innovation and ambiance, upscale dining establishments in Heliopolis or Katameya offering sophisticated experiences.
